Businesses offered unique support service
5:50pm Monday 22nd October 2012 in News
BUSINESSES in Redditch and Bromsgrove are being offered a unique service to help them grow and flourish.
Steph Middleton is managing director of Redditch-based firm Outhouse-UK, a virtual assistant service for small businesses and entrepreneurs.
Virtual assistants can remotely provide administrative, technical and creative support from typing up notes to project management.
Mrs Middleton said: “Businesses are often in a position to expand and grow but all the focus is going into completing the day-to-day tasks.
“Taking on additional permanent staff may not give them the flexibility or skill set they would ideally like.”
She added that the virtual assistant industry as a key player in supporting business development, in turn supporting the creation of jobs and economic growth.
Local businessman Gavin Townsend, from GT Personal Training, said: “I have experienced considerable growth as a result of being able to focus on the things that matter.
“My business wouldn’t be where it is today without the use of the virtual assistant and in my case the services of Outhouse.”
